Running as the Reform Party nominee in the 1996 U.S. presidential election with Pat Choate as his vice presidential nominee, Perot received 8 percent of the popular vote, while the Republican candidate, Bob Dole, took 41 percent, and Clinton was reelected with 49 percent of the vote and 379 electoral college delegates.

Bob Dole, who is now retired from politics, was a long-serving member of Congress in the both the House and Senate. Dole was in the House of Representatives from 1961 – 1969 and the U.S. Senate from 1969 – 1996. Before running for president as the Republican nominee in 1996, Dole was chosen as Gerald Ford’s running mate in 1976.
